What is the XSLL stock forecast for 2030?
No analyst covering Xsolla SPAC 1 publishes a 2030 price target — Wall Street targets run 12 to 18 months out. Sites quoting a 2030 price for XSLL are extrapolating price history, which says nothing about the business.

About Xsolla SPAC 1.
Xsolla SPAC 1 is a blank check company formed to effect a merger, amalgamation, share exchange, asset acquisition, share purchase, reorganization, or similar business combination with one or more businesses. It targets companies with enterprise values between $500 million and $1 billion, particularly in sectors such as video games, FinTech, AdTech, and telecom. The company operates within the diversified financials sector, specifically in asset management and custody banks. Its units consist of one Class A ordinary share and one-half of one redeemable warrant. Leadership includes Chairman Aleksandr Agapitov, founder and CEO of Xsolla, a global video game commerce company, and CEO Dmitry Burkovskiy, CIO of Xsolla. Xsolla SPAC 1 provides investors access to potential opportunities in high-growth industries through the SPAC structure, facilitating capital raising for future acquisitions without current operational revenues. Founded in 2025 and headquartered in Sherman Oaks, California, it plays a role in the market for special purpose acquisition vehicles seeking innovative targets.
